Adds the Squatwatch scanner to the release pipeline. Flags packages with names within edit distance of our internal registry entries, plus suspicious publish timing. Scan runs pre-promotion; failures block the release. False-positive allowlist lives in config. No runtime impact on shipped artifacts. The detection thresholds are set as follows.

tuning table, kajog-bawip:
TIERS = {
    "kelius": 256,
    "lammir": 543,
}

Ticket TL-442: The staging instance of Chronoplan, our school timetable solver, was deployed with the production solver queue credentials. This means staging runs can enqueue jobs against live district schedules at Hollowbrook Academy. We need to rotate the affected credential and point staging at its own queue. For the security review, note that the fix requires updating the staging .env with the following line:

vault entry, tagug-hahip: ARCHIVE_KEY3=e34

The flaky integration tests in the Tollgate payments service mostly trace back to the shared sandbox ledger getting wiped mid-run by parallel CI jobs. Reviewers: reject any PR that reintroduces shared-state fixtures; each test must provision its own merchant account via the Sandforge helper. The helper runs under the tollgate-ci service account, which has scoped access to the sandbox ledger only. If you need to reproduce a flake locally, authenticate the helper against the sandbox endpoint using the key below.

API key for tagef-fafop: vxb2-ta

**Q: Why does the Wrenhall Gallery audio guide stop mid-tour?**

The Murmur app pauses playback when a visitor leaves a gallery's beacon range, and some rooms in the east wing have weak coverage. Advise visitors to re-tap the exhibit code; progress is saved. Coverage maps and the current workaround list are on the internal page here.

runbook for badug-kadup: https://confluence.zemvarlabs.internal/projects/browse/display/projects/bd1b